    I am using Z3 model. I am unable to update my mobile to the latest OS 10.3.2. I have tried the three methods specified in the BlackBerry website 1.On the web 2.BlackBerry Link 3.Over-The-Air to update the OS. But all the methods have encountered some issues.

    I have got some 1.4 GB of free space in my mobile before updating and below are the details of the issue.

    1. On the web and BlackBerry Link :
    When using these two options I can able to download only 45% - 55% of the update. After that I am getting a message as "Software Update encountered an error". I have tried couple of times to download the update but the result is the same. Not sure what the issue is.
    Unable to update OS 10.3.2-untitled.png

    2.Over-The-Air:
    When using this option I can able to download the full update (408 MB). But at the time of installing the software only between 212 MB - 240 MB got installed and after that I get a message "Software download was interrupted. Please try again latter". Again I have tried to update, but getting the same error message. Not sure what the issue is.

    You need well over 3GB free space for an OTA update of this size.

    You should backup your device with Link, use Link to 'reload OS' or use an autoloader, then restore using Link.
